Product Introduction

The GE IC660BBA023 Thermocouple Input Module is a high-performance, industrial-grade thermocouple input block designed for temperature monitoring and control in automated systems. Part of the Genius I/O series by GE Fanuc (now GE Automation & Controls), this module provides precise analog input readings for various types of thermocouples, ensuring compatibility with a wide range of industrial processes.

Designed for robust environments, it integrates seamlessly with other Genius I/O blocks and PLCs, offering durability, scalability, and reliability in harsh operating conditions. It’s widely used in industries such as power generation, oil and gas, food processing, chemical manufacturing, and more.

The IC660BBA023 is recognized for its compact design, easy installation, and advanced diagnostic features, making it an ideal choice for mission-critical applications where temperature accuracy is paramount.


Product Specifications

Parameter Details
Manufacturer GE (General Electric)
Part Number IC660BBA023
Product Type Thermocouple Input Block
Input Channels 6 Analog Thermocouple Inputs
Compatible Thermocouple Types Types J, K, T, E, R, S, B, N
Input Range -270°C to +1800°C (depends on thermocouple type)
Resolution 0.1°C
Update Time ≤500 ms
Isolation Optical Isolation between channels and logic
Diagnostic Features Open sensor detection, over-range, under-range, short detection
Power Supply 24 VDC nominal (operating range 20–30 VDC)
Mounting DIN Rail or Panel Mounting
Communications Interface Genius I/O bus
Operating Temperature -20°C to +60°C
Storage Temperature -40°C to +85°C
Humidity 5% to 95% non-condensing
Shock and Vibration Resistance Designed to withstand industrial environments
Dimensions (H x W x D) 60 x 120 x 30 mm
Weight 0.15 kg
Agency Approvals CE, UL, CSA, FM Class 1 Div 2

Frequently Asked Questions (FAQ)

  1. Q: What thermocouple types are supported by the IC660BBA023?
    A: It supports Types J, K, T, E, R, S, B, and N thermocouples.

  2. Q: Can this module be used in high-vibration environments?
    A: Yes, it is built to withstand industrial shock and vibration levels.

  3. Q: How many input channels does it offer?
    A: It provides 6 individual thermocouple input channels.

  4. Q: Does the module support open sensor detection?
    A: Yes, it includes diagnostics for open sensor and wiring faults.

  5. Q: What is the input resolution?
    A: The input resolution is typically 0.1°C, depending on thermocouple type.

  6. Q: Is it compatible with modern PLC systems?
    A: Yes, especially those supporting the Genius Bus like GE Series 90-30, 90-70, and RX3i.

  7. Q: What are the power requirements for the IC660BBA023?
    A: It operates on a 24 VDC nominal power supply.

  8. Q: Can it be panel-mounted or only DIN rail mounted?
    A: It supports both panel and DIN rail mounting options.

  9. Q: Is there a built-in cold junction compensation?
    A: Yes, the module provides cold junction compensation for thermocouple accuracy.

  10. Q: What certifications does it have?
    A: It is certified by CE, UL, CSA, and FM for industrial use.
